Now Reynolds has done the same for none other than Betty White, for her 96th birthday. The Instagram post wishes a happy birthday to the actress, who has only grown more popular in her later years, becoming a sort of internet sensation and beloved icon for millennials due to her sharp wit.
This follows on from the strange running joke in Deadpool that the costumed anti-hero, Wade Wilson, is a little obsessed with The Golden Girls. In the first movie, Wade can be seen wearing a t-shirt featuring Bea Arthur, one of the stars of the show. This was actually something Reynolds fought to include, even ringing up one of Arthur's sons himself to get permission to use her likeness in the movie. He then made further reference to Arthur in a recent Instagram photo from the set of Deadpool 2.

But this isn't just a one-sided relationship. White appeared with Reynolds in The Proposal, where you can bet Reynolds spoke to her about her former show. You may have missed it, but Betty White actually released a 'review' of Deadpool back in 2016. "I just saw the most anticipated movie of the year, Deadpool," White said in the video. "It was glorious!

"Once in a generation a movie comes along that your whole family will love. If your family is a f***ed up bunch of French-kissing imbreds. Plus, Ryan Reynolds is so f***ing handsome in his red leather suit."
"I give it four Golden Girls. It's the best picture of the year."
